[{"type":"text","content":"PITTSBURGH, July 26, 2023 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Krystal Biotech, Inc. (the “Company”) (NASDAQ: KRYS), a commercial-stage biotechnology company focused on the discovery, development and commercialization of genetic medicines to treat diseases with high unmet medical needs, announced today that it has expanded its R&D pipeline to oncology and that the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has accepted its Investigational New Drug (IND) application of its lead oncology drug candidate KB707 for the treatment of locally advanced or metastatic solid tumor malignancies. KB707 is a modified HSV-1 vector designed to deliver genes encoding both human IL-12 and IL-2 to the tumor microenvironment and promote systemic immune-mediated tumor clearance. Two formulations of KB707 are in development, a solution formulation for transcutaneous injection and an inhaled (nebulized) formulation for lung delivery. “We believe KB707 is a unique and highly differentiated drug candidate with the potential to unlock the capabilities of cytokine-based immunotherapy,” said Suma Krishnan, President of Research & Development at Krystal Biotech. “By enabling localized and sustained cytokine expression within a treated tumor, KB707 has the potential to maximize therapeutic efficacy while avoiding the tolerability challenges of systemic cytokine treatments.” The FDA has accepted the Company’s IND to evaluate intratumoral KB707 in patients with solid tumors accessible by transcutaneous injection, and the Company expects to initiate a Phase 1 study in the second half of 2023.
